Overview

During the Middle Ages, the silver mines of Kutna Hora brought fame to the lands of the Czech Crown, making this town the richest and most powerful in the region. Today, the mining town boasts several UNESCO-listed sites and retains its medieval architecture, history, and heritage.

Your tour begins with pickup in central Prague. Hop aboard your coach and begin the journey toward Kutna Hora.

Upon arrival, follow your guide to discover the area’s top sites. Admire the Gothic design of St. Barbara's Cathedral, dedicated to the patron saint of miners, and now a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Stop at the former royal mint that once manufactured Prague groschen and gold ducats. Visit the Sedlec Ossuary, also known as the 'bone church,' a small chapel estimated to display the skeletons of 40,000 to 70,000 people, each arranged artistically to form the chapel’s décor.

Your tour concludes with transportation back to your original departure point in Prague.
